Korean Fried Chicken with a Unique Twist #NeighborhoodSpotlight #movemetotx

Houston has a lot of Asian cuisine but one culture that doesn’t have as much representation as the others is Korean. This restaurant is determined to help change that. For this week’s #NeighborhoodSpotlight, join us as we talk to Jason Cho, the owner of Dak & Bop.

Dak & Bop originally opened back in 2014 with a different location over in the Houston Museum district. Since then, that location has closed and a new concept within the Dak & Bop brand was born and is housed on West 18th Street in the Houston Heights. The idea behind this location is a chef driven menu with an elevated gastropub feel. They take traditional dishes and give them a unique spin with their ingredients and presentation. There is also a distinct Italian influence on their menu at this particular location.

Japanese Kitchen with a Seasonally Rotating Menu, Houston, #NeighborhoodSpotlight #movemetotx

This next spot blends Japanese techniques with Houston flavors and ingredients to deliver a unique and delicious experience. For this week’s #NeighborhoodSpotlight, join us as we talk to Naoki Yoshida, the owner and chef behind Shun Japanese Kitchen.

Shun Japanese Kitchen opened its doors in Houston back in 2018. Their goal is to really explore new realms of Japanese cuisine through the eyes of, in their words, “2nd Generation Japanese-American.” They have the mindset of a Japanese Kitchen but have a mix of new and unique flavors and foods that they incorporate into their menu. Even their dining room reflects their theme of traditional meets modern with an eclectic mix of traditional Japanese décor and pops of modern graffiti.
